Brady Tkachuk and the coach of Ottawa have to deal with a family situation that isn’t disappearing easily.

Tkachuk spoke openly about the podcast reaction, and how he expressed himself was important. He didn’t make the situation worse, didn’t separate himself from his dad, and didn’t try to clean up his father’s words with a more polished statement in public.

Instead, he chose to tread carefully.

He mentioned that he really respects his father, referred to him as someone who will probably make it into the Hall of Fame, and made it clear he wouldn’t speak for his dad or clarify what his dad said.

This response shows how Tkachuk wanted to address the issue. He protected his dad but didn’t completely take responsibility for his father’s comments. This is a tricky position to manage, especially in an environment where one statement can quickly become a big story.

He also mentioned an important point. Tkachuk said that if you know his dad, you realize he is friendly, speaks his mind, and that his intentions are good.

Brady Tkachuk on the podcast remarks: “I really respect my dad. He’s going to be a Hall of Famer so I’m not going to speak for him or clarify what he said. If you know him, he’s a friendly person, speaks what’s on his mind, and I know it comes from a good place. ”
